Domaine de la Tour: Normandy, France
Property
Two gîtes (formerly the stables of a chateau built by Louis XV) in an 18th century farmhouse, situated in peaceful countryside close to the town of Falaise, Lower Normandy. Each unit has 4 bedrooms (over 3 floors, with top and bottom safety gates on the stairs), fully equipped kitchen, an open plan living room, TV/DVD player, and private fenced garden.
Location
Domaine de la Tour is situated 1km off the main road, surrounded by 500 hectares (whatever those are) of forest and agricultural land. The nearest town is Falaise, just a few minutes drive away where you will find two large supermarkets, a variety of shops, restaurants, banks, bakeries, an aquatic center and weekly market on Saturday morning. It is within 30 minutes of the nearest coast and 20 minutes of Caen by motorway.
Sleeps
2-8.
Highlights
Laundry facilities. Paddocks with farm animals for your children to pet (April through November). Shared playroom with oodles of toys for small children, and table tennis for older children.
Good to know
Pack light. The people who run Domaine de la Tour can provide just about anything child-related that your heart may desire. See web site for details.

4 Rue de la Dives: Magny, France

Property
An 18th century former farm in Basse Normandie (Lower Normandy to toi et moi) converted into a luxury holiday property perfect for families with babies and toddlers.
Location
Number Four is situated in the small commune of Magny on the outskirts of Trun. It falls within the department of Orne and is within 55 minutes of the coast and 45 minutes from Caen. Trun is a typical small French town with a range of shops including three bakeries, a butchers, supermarket, traditional grocers and a bank with cash machine.
Sleeps
3-8.
Highlights
Securely fenced pool. Enclosed garden. Bikes with child seats. Large and fully-equipped playroom.
Good to know
You probably won’t find everything you need in the small village markets. Go to the large hypermarket (supermarket) in nearby Argentan to stock up.

La Cour aux Bourgeois: Villers Canivet, France
Property
A gorgeous rambling 17th century farmhouse (complete with orchard, playbarn, sandbox, wading pool, TV with English language channels and BBQ) comprising 3 apartments in the heart of the Norman countryside. The Anglo-French owners offer a relaxing and restful environ ment with a unique combination of the flexibility and living space of self-catering accommodation and the optional services of a small hotel. Stylish yet extremely child-friendly décor. These people really get it.
Location
The house is located in the small village of Villers Canivet, five minutes drive from the historic town of Falaise in Normandy. It’s just 40 mins from the ferry port of Caen, and easy to reach by sea, train, or air. Close by are chateaux, local markets, beaches (40 minutes), and sporting activities, however you may just want to stay closer to home, lazing in the hammock in the orchard or taking a gentle stroll to the local boulangerie for fresh bread and croissants.
Sleeps
3-7
Highlights
Looking forward to French cuisine, but not with your unruly kids? For not very many euro per person, your hosts will deliver a gourmet 3-course meal (wine included) after bedtime, and collect the dirty dishes afterwards. Can you spell v-a-c-a-t-i-o-n?
Good to know
17th century childproofing isn’t always up to modern standards. Close and lock those upstairs shutters for peace of mind.
